Southeast Asia’s tech boom has stalled. Can it find its spark again?

For the fourth consecutive year, the otherwise warm and sunny Singapore continues to battle a prolonged and crippling funding winter.

Whilst Singapore continues to attract 92% of South East Asia’s (SEA) tech startup funding, as per recent reports from the data intelligence platform, Tracxn, the overall funding raised in the region in the first half of the year has dropped by 24% compared to the second half of 2024, to just US$2 billion ($2.6 billion).
